JUDGMENT
Learned counsel for the appellants-Revenue has.placed before us a recent Circular No.21/2015 dated|10.12.2015, issued by the Central Board of Direct taxes,wherein the monetary limit of the tax eftect for filing appealsbefore the High Court has been enhanced from Rs.10 lacs to |Rs.20 lacs.
before the High Court has been enhanced from Rs.10 lacs to |
In paragraph-10 of the said Circular, it has beenclarified that the same will apply retrospectively to pending|appeals also, which, if below the specified tax limits, may bewithdrawn/not pressed.
2.Learned counsel for the appellants has stated.that the tax effect in the present appeal is below the specifiedlimit of Rs.20 lacs.
3.Accordingly, in view of the Circular No.21/2010dated 10.12.2015, the tax effect in this appeal being less|than Rs.20 lacs, the appeal standsdismissed.
